Anthropic is seeking a Research Engineer in London, who will build evaluations for catastrophic risks related to AI. This role involves designing experiments, collaborating with experts in AI safety, and influencing company decisions using AI safety levels.
Candidates should have a strong background in machine learning, preferably with experience in Python, and be capable of managing collaborative research projects.
The compensation ranges between £260,000 and £420,000, with additional benefits including private health insurance and unlimited PTO.
